Interview: The Saturdays

We catch up with Una Healy from The Saturdays to talk about their latest single ‘Gentleman’, who’s the best drunk and which 90’s men are worth of the ‘Gentleman’ title!

Saturdays-Intervew

It’s not everyday we get the chance to chat to one of worlds hottest girl-bands so when the email dropped asking if we wanted to have a chat with one of the girls from The Saturdays about their new single ‘Gentleman’ (Out Now) we jumped at the chance. We gave irish beauty Una Healy a bell a few days before the release of the single to talk details. We find out who’s got the best rap skillz, find out which 90’s men are worthy of the ‘Gentleman’ title and ask what they really mean when they say ‘Taste My Rainbow’.

HTF: So your new single ‘Gentleman’ is out Sunday?
U: Yeh on the 30th. Quite a significant date for me as myself and Ben are married a year on the 30th so it’s our anniversary weekend. Double whammy!

HTF: Congrats! Is the single gonna be another number 1?
U: I don’t know. Hopefully a double celebration. We are just so pleased we have had a number one now cus we always had that question “Oh, could this be the number one?” so at least we don’t have that pressure and people can’t really ask us that anymore. We are so delighted to have had a number one but we were around for a few years without having one and it didn’t seem to stop us. Even a top 10 we would be thrilled with.

HTF: Yeh, cus you formed in 2007 right?
U: Yeh 6 years since we got together and 5 years since the first single. It’s gone by so fast.

HTF: Well hopefully with all your recent promotion in America we can get you a U.S number 1 now?
U: Oh gosh yeah! Hopefully!

HTF: So on ‘Gentleman’ you have all started doing some rapping. Is this because you have been hanging out with Flo Rida and Sean Paul too much?
U: Yeh their influence has probably rubbed off yeah. *laughs* It’s more like fast talking rather than rapping. We try our best anyway and it’s something different for us as well.

HTF: Were any of the girls particularly good and surprised you?
U: If I had to pick one who was the best it would probably be Vanessa. She’s got the most, the biggest chunk. She’s the best. She wouldn’t want to admit that but she’s got that sorta ‘swag’ or whatever you wanna call it. She can pull it off better than the rest of us.

HTF: So, everyones asking about the new album. Do you have a name for it yet?
U: We haven’t confirmed a title yet but should be out in the autumn time. We had a few sort-of working titles but haven’t settled yet.

HTF: Are we gonna be seeing a different side to The Saturdays this time?
U: It’s all still very Saturdays still. We’ve got a bit of everything. We’ve got some up-tempo songs, a couple of really heart-felt ballads. It’s pop music really.

HTF: You actually play guitar and write your own songs. Do you get involved with the writing process at all?
U: Normally when we do acoustic sessions it’s a set part of our show but I don’t pick a guitar up in the studio. I wouldn’t be good enough for that I don’t think.

HTF: Don’t put yourself down. You never know!
U: I would love to. I can’t this album but maybe next album I would love to do a nice ballad just acoustic as one of the bonus tracks or something. Just guitar and nothing else. That’s very similar to what I used to do before I was in the band. It’s not exactly very Saturdays. I’m not sure if the fans would like it or not.That’s the only thing.

HTF: I’m sure they would love it! Didn’t you release your own EP a while back?
U: Yeh, it was that kinda sound. Very acoustic, very simple and not a lot of heavy production. You could re-create it live very easily. That was before I was in the group.

HTF: We gonna looking at a tour later in the year?
U: We got Frankie who’s expecting a baby later in the year so we won’t be going on tour without her so once she has had her baby and ready to come back we will hopefully tour early next year. That’s the plan.
